Prevention of Colorectal Cancer Through Multiomics Blood Testing

Condition: Colon Cancer · Rectal Cancer · Colon Neoplasm  ·  Sponsor: Freenome Holdings Inc.

PhaseN/A
Planned participants48995
Who can joinAll sexes, 45 Years to 85 Years
Healthy volunteersYes

About this study

The PREEMPT CRC study is a prospective multi-center observational study to validate a blood-based test for the early detection of colorectal cancer by collecting blood samples from average-risk participants who will undergo a routine screening colonoscopy.
